Will Cardone Capital’s Bold Bitcoin Strategy Pay Off With Their 130 BTC Acquisition?
In the latest development in the crypto-financial sphere, Cardone Capital has strategically expanded its Bitcoin portfolio by acquiring an additional 130 BTC. This transaction was financed through a Miami River refinance deal at a rate of 4.89%. Furthermore, the company has disclosed that eight more similar transactions are set to follow, building on the momentum from its previous acquisition of 1,000 BTC in June. This move is part of a broader strategy aiming to amass 4,000 BTC by 2025.
The launch of the 10X Miami River Bitcoin Fund marks a significant milestone for Cardone Capital. This new fund is not only backed by a substantial 346-unit property but also bolsters its assets with $15 million in Bitcoin.
